Vice President, Development

Hillwood Communities

The Role

Overview

Lead master‑planned community development from concept to completion, managing strategy and execution.

Tasks

-Serve as the company’s project ambassador to municipalities, builder clients, and key industry professionals. -Lead project sales meetings and interpret market analytics and performance trends to inform strategy. -Lead regular site tours, prepare investment summaries, and present updates to executive leadership and stakeholders. -Ensure continuity in design, service, and Hillwood brand standards throughout development cycles. -Cultivate relationships with elected officials, municipal staff, and local/regional influencers. -Direct the establishment and operation of the community homeowner’s association and related management teams. -Coordinate post-delivery efforts including best practices documentation, resident engagement strategies, and amenity activation. -Facilitate cross-functional collaboration between internal associates, homebuilder teams, and third-party vendors. -Manage and mentor project team members to ensure goals, milestones, and standards are met and exceeded. -Provide strategic vision and leadership across all phases of development. -Provide oversight of public financing districts, including Municipal Utility Districts (MUDs), assessments, and compliance reporting. -Coordinate closely with and direct the Development Manager on phasing, entitlements, amenity execution, budget control, and scheduling. -Maintain regular interface with planners, engineers, architects, legal advisors, financial consultants, brokers, marketing teams, and other partners. -Manage, track, and create project life budgets, forecasting, and cost reporting. -Oversee builder engagement including contract preparation, amendments, pricing coordination, and project delivery expectations. -Guide land development, infrastructure, vertical construction, and retail parcel strategy. -Direct the development and execution of community business plans integrating land planning, infrastructure, financial strategy, and marketing objectives. -Prepare and present annual project business plans to senior and executive leadership. -Collaborate with retail brokers and negotiate land sale transactions.

What You Bring

The ideal candidate will bring extensive experience in master-planned community development, a track record of effective cross-functional leadership, and the ability to craft and execute business plans that drive long-term value. The Vice President of Development will play a critical in transforming strategic plans into tangible outcomes, ensuring every project reflects Hillwood Communities’ standards for innovation, quality, and lasting impact. -Experience with master-planned communities, residential infrastructure, amenity design, and vertical construction. -Financial acumen including budget tracking, forecasting, and investment summaries. -Reputation for professionalism, credibility, and stakeholder trust. -Strategic thinker with the ability to operationalize long-term goals. -Minimum 5 years in senior-level project leadership, overseeing entitlements, infrastructure delivery, and construction execution. -Ability to guide and coach cross-functional teams through ambiguity and complexity. -Proven leadership in high-stakes, multi-phase development projects. -Strong interpersonal and relationship-building skills across public and private sectors. -Demonstrated understanding of public financing structures such as Municipal Utility Districts (MUDs) is required. -Expert negotiation skills with a solutions-oriented mindset. -Bachelor’s Degree required in Real Estate Development, Finance, Urban Planning, Civil Engineering, Construction Management, or related field; MBA or Master’s Degree in related field highly preferred. -Excellent written, verbal, and presentation abilities. -Minimum 10–15 years of progressive experience in residential land development with a strong emphasis in master-planned communities.

About Hillwood Communities

-Blend visionary thinking with hometown roots to shape communities where life, work, and play converge. -Privately held and family‑led under the Perot legacy, focusing on long‑term placemaking rather than short‑term returns. -Financial patience enabled landmark developments like AllianceTexas. -Projects range from agrihoods to urban enclaves, including community farms and lakeside living. -Specializes in residential, commercial, and mixed‑use projects, integrating homes, offices, retail, schools, and parks. -Developments often feature amenities like tree‑house clubs, ninja fitness courses, kayak waterways, and regional parks.
